When it comes to brewing the perfect cup of coffee, enthusiasts often find themselves pondering a critical question: Does the brand of coffee maker matter? This inquiry delves deeper than mere brand loyalty; it encompasses factors such as brewing technology, build quality, user experience, and long-term value. In this post, we will explore these dimensions to provide a comprehensive understanding of how the brand of your coffee maker can influence your coffee experience.
1. Brewing Technology: The Heart of the Matter
At the core of any coffee maker’s performance lies its brewing technology. Different brands employ varying methods, which can significantly affect the extraction process. For instance, brands like Breville and Technivorm utilize advanced thermal brewing systems that maintain optimal water temperatures, ensuring a balanced extraction of flavors. In contrast, lower-end brands may rely on basic drip mechanisms that can lead to inconsistent brewing temperatures, resulting in a subpar cup of coffee.
Moreover, some brands incorporate features such as programmable settings, which allow users to customize brew strength and temperature. This level of control can be particularly beneficial for coffee aficionados who appreciate the nuances of different coffee beans. Therefore, investing in a reputable brand often translates to superior brewing technology, which can enhance the overall quality of your coffee.
2. Build Quality and Durability
Another critical aspect to consider is the build quality of the coffee maker. Established brands typically invest in higher-quality materials and rigorous testing processes, leading to more durable products. For example, brands like Cuisinart and KitchenAid are known for their robust construction, which not only ensures longevity but also enhances user safety.
Conversely, lesser-known brands may cut corners in material selection, resulting in coffee makers that are prone to malfunction or wear over time. A coffee maker that breaks down frequently can lead to frustration and additional costs, negating any initial savings from purchasing a cheaper model. Thus, the brand’s reputation for quality can be a significant factor in determining the long-term value of your investment.
3. User Experience and Customer Support
User experience is another vital consideration when evaluating coffee maker brands. Established brands often provide intuitive designs, making it easier for users to navigate settings and maintain their machines. For instance, brands like Nespresso offer user-friendly interfaces and convenient cleaning cycles, enhancing the overall brewing experience.
Additionally, customer support is an essential aspect of the user experience. Reputable brands typically offer comprehensive warranties and responsive customer service, ensuring that users can resolve any issues that may arise. In contrast, lesser-known brands may lack adequate support, leaving users stranded with malfunctioning equipment. This difference in customer service can significantly impact your satisfaction with the product over time.
4. Brand Reputation and Reviews
In the age of information, consumer reviews and brand reputation play a crucial role in the decision-making process. Established brands often have a wealth of reviews and testimonials that provide insights into their products’ performance and reliability. Websites like Consumer Reports and specialty coffee forums can offer valuable information on how different brands stack up against each other.
Moreover, brand reputation can influence resale value. High-quality brands tend to retain their value better than lesser-known counterparts, making them a more prudent investment in the long run. Therefore, considering the brand’s standing in the market can provide additional context when deciding on a coffee maker.
Conclusion: The Brand Matters
In conclusion, the brand of your coffee maker does matter. From brewing technology and build quality to user experience and brand reputation, the choice of brand can significantly influence your coffee experience. While it may be tempting to opt for a budget-friendly option, investing in a reputable brand can yield dividends in terms of quality, durability, and satisfaction. Ultimately, the right coffee maker can transform your daily ritual into a delightful experience, making the exploration of different brands a worthwhile endeavor for any coffee lover.
